This small 8 x 8 (64 LED) dot matrix is only 1.25" (32mm) square, and ready to display any scrolling text, graphs, clock display, counter or signs you can think of! The ultra-bright LEDs are very visible, and the units are small enough to plug into a breadboard! The LEDs are contained inside the plastic body in an 8x8 matrix. There are 16 pins on the side, 8 on each, with 0.1" spacing so you can easily plug it into a breadboard with one row on each side for wiring it up.
This dot matrix requires an IC to run, and the display is in a grid so you'll need a 1:8 multiplex to control it. You can run it with a MAX7219 which does the multiplexing for you.
